1/28 (Day 79)(Day 42 Flower)
Today makes 6 weeks in flower. Supposed to give straight water this feeding, but decided to add the Cha-Ching soluble.(1/2 tsp)
This is the last the BW will get as far as nutrients. Before feeding, I ran 10 gallons of pH 6.8 water through the pot, got a good bit of the FF "leftovers" out. :thumbsup: Going to flush heavily at her next watering. Still a lot of greenery, only the very tips of the BWs leaves have yellowed.
The X2d and KK get 1/2 strength Big Bloom and the Cha-Ching. These two will get one more full feeding before flushing them. The KKs fans are getting sucked dry, especially the ones closest to the biggest blooms. The X2 fans are gradually fading.

2/5 (Day 87)(Day 50 Flower)
The plants are just about dry from the good soaking on 1/28. The BW gets flushed with plain pH 6.8 water. Ran 14 gallons through, till the runoff ppm came down a good bit. Added 1 tsp of molasses to the final gallon.
I sure wish I had a floor drain handy! :) Flushing is a PITA. :D
Purely guessing that this one will finish @ 9 weeks. She's frosting fairly decently, now. :thumbsup: I was a bit disappointed at first, but she's fillin' out and looking much better, now. All the foliage hides the bud growth along the lower branches, but there's more there than I thought. Nothing fancy with the smell of the plant, very generic spicy/skunky odor.
I don't have any cuts from this one. If the smoke proves to be worthwhile, I'll reveg what's left of her, as a mom.

2/5 (Day 87)(Day 50 Flower)
KK is still chugging away. :cool: Really bulking up, having to tie up quite a few branches. This one is a keeper, she'll be hanging around for future grows. :thumbsup:
FF week 11 schedule @ FS. This is her last full feeding, next watering I'll start flushing out all the FF leftovers. Upon flushing the BW, it's quite apparent that there is a good bit of built up salts in the soil. The FFOF has done a good job of buffering any harmful changes in soil chemistry.

2/5 (Day 87)(Day 50 Flower)
This one's the puzzler. She came on strong early, then just hit a slow/steady stride. New flower growth has been consistent, but slower. The trichome formation is there, but nothing like the other two. Ive seen nothing but clear trichs on this one. This one may be a real-long flowering girl. She seems stable, no errant male flowers yet. Steady as she goes... ;)
